Bosman Upper Hemel-en-Aarde Pinot Noir 2024

Colour: A lively ruby red.
Nose: Bright red berries with enticing hints of freshly dug earth and allspice.
Palate: The nose translates beautifully on the palate with tart raspberry flavours, a silky elegance and a fresh, lingering finish.

Perfect served lightly chilled on its own or with cured meats, flavourful salads or mildly spiced Middle Eastern dishes.

in the vineyard : From our south-facing vineyards, overlooking Walker Bay on the higher reaches of the Babylonstoren Mountains.

in the cellar : The grapes were hand-picked and cooled overnight, then hand-sorted and destemmed before entering the cellar. After five days of cold maceration on the skins, alcoholic fermentation was initiated. Regular pump-overs during the three-week fermentation assured soft tannins, increased flavour and a deeper colour. Wine was matured for six months in French oak barrels – 15% new oak.
